- Scope and content:
-
The Blue Book Student Handbook Collection contains Barnard College's annualStudent Handbook, from 1904 - 2013. The Student Handbook is a brief yet extensive guide to the College, providing vital information, such as locations of offices and hours, listings of clubs/organizations and residential buildings, maps, various rules (dorm, fire safety, alcohol/drugs, etc.), among other information.
- Biographical / historical:
-
TheBarnard College Blue Book was an annual booklet originally published by the Barnard Christian Association. TheBarnard College Blue Book contained all the information thought to be relevant to student life. TheBarnard College Blue Book was renamed theBarnard Student Handbook in 1961, and was published by the Undergraduate Association. In the 1970s, the Office of Public Relations was in charge of publication and the handbook was referred to asA Guide to Barnard, then in 1983, as theBarnard Student Guide. In 1988, it became theBarnard Handbook and Student Guide, and contained a calendar/planner component. In 1990, the handbook was referred to as theBarnard College Calendar and Student Guide, and in 1997, theBarnard College Student Handbook. Presently, the handbook is called theStudent Handbook.
